Philosophy
The principles that guide VLLNT UI design and development.
Philosophy
VLLNT UI is built on a set of core principles that guide every design decision and implementation choice.
Minimalist Design
Less is more. Every component is designed with simplicity at its core. We believe that good design should be invisible—it should work seamlessly without drawing unnecessary attention to itself. Our components are:
- Clean and uncluttered
- Focused on essential functionality
- Free from decorative elements
- Purposeful in every detail
Dark Mode First
Dark mode isn't an afterthought—it's the primary design direction. Every component is crafted with dark backgrounds in mind, ensuring optimal readability and visual comfort. Light mode is available, but dark mode is where VLLNT UI truly shines.
- Designed for low-light environments
- Reduced eye strain
- Modern aesthetic
- Professional appearance
No Emoji Style
We maintain a professional, text-based approach. Emojis and decorative icons are kept to a minimum, ensuring our components remain timeless and universally applicable.
- Text-first communication
- Professional tone
- Universal compatibility
- Clean typography
Fast Components
Performance is not negotiable. Every component is optimized for speed and efficiency:
- Lightweight implementations
- Minimal dependencies
- Optimized rendering
- Fast load times
Technical Excellence
Beyond aesthetics, VLLNT UI prioritizes:
- Type Safety: Built with TypeScript for reliability
- Accessibility: WCAG compliant components
- Customization: Easy to extend and modify
- Modern Standards: Built on latest web technologies
Getting Started
All components follow these principles. When you use VLLNT UI, you're not just adding components—you're adopting a philosophy of clean, fast, and purposeful design.